The committee advanced a resolution of intention to establish the Top of Broadway Community Benefit District after OEWD and Supervisor David Chu described a proposed 39‑parcel district, an annual budget of about $106,567 and a $100,000 per‑year two‑year donation to help launch services focused on beautification, security and economic development.

The Government Audit and Oversight Committee voted without objection to advance a resolution of intention to create the Top of Broadway Community Benefit District (CBD), following a presentation from Supervisor David Chu and the Office of Economic and Workforce Development.
